WebMay 1, 2005 · Cyclical progestogen preparations are often associated with irregular bleeding and spotting, whereas some regimens of pro- gestogens are used to treat irregular cycles, especially when due to anovulation. WebJan 23, 2008 · Progestogens administered from day 15 or 19 to day 26 of the cycle offer no advantage over other medical therapies such as danazol, tranexamic acid,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) and the IUS in the treatment of menorrhagia in women with ovulatory cycles. One of the most discussed prognosis models of modern futures studies is the Kondratiev Cycle. It postulates a regular pattern of upswings and downswings in the economy, ranging over 50 to 60 years.
